ID number: BIRBI-LR0314 Object type: Coin
Institution: The Barber Institute of Fine Arts Named collection: P. D. Whitting Collection Collector: Whitting, Philip D. Maker: Arcadius; Aquileia Denomination: Follis Place made: Europe: Italy, Aquileia Culture: Late Roman Date made: 388-393 Metal: Base Metal Diameter (cm): 1.32 Weight (g): 1.46 Axis (degrees): 180.00 Provenance: Whitting 2303. Ex Hugh de Sausmarez Shortt Collection, 25th of July 1953. |

|
Description: Obverse: Bust of Arcadius, facing r. draped, cuirassed, diademed. Reverse: Victory dragging captive with l. hand, a Christogram in l. field.
Inscriptions: Obverse: D N ΛΠCΛDI VS P P Λ… (our lord Arcadius pious fortunate Augustus). Reverse: S□LVS H… AE (health of the Republic). Mint mark: ΠQP· (mint of Aquileia).
Bibliography: RIC IX 58c
